As far as 2007's music is concerned:
The Historical Conquests of Josh Ritter - I can't say this enough.
Wincing the Night Away by The Shins - Not their best work, but still pretty decent.
Neon Bible by Arcade Fire - This is a hit or miss album, the people that like it really like it, and the people that don't really hate it. That's how it seemed, at least.
We Were Dead Before The Ship Even Sank by Modest Mouse - Nuff said.
Year Zero by Nine Inch Nails - Finally, something listenable since The Fragile.
Anonymous by Tomahawk - I haven't heard this album enough to really comment, but what I recall right now, I really like.
Our Love To Admire by Interpol - Don't expect anything new here, but if you liked the last two CDs, you'll like this.
Dethalbum by Dethklok - Actually a really strong release from a "fake" band.
...And The Family Telephone by Page France - My favorite by them by far.
